About The Position

The Project Engineer / Assistant Project Manager (PE/APM) supports the Construction team in delivering multi-site fitness club TI projects on schedule, on budget, and to VASA design standards. Operating in an owner-side capacity, the PE/APM partners with Project Managers to drive day-to-day execution: coordinating with GCs, architects, vendors, and landlords; managing project documentation and financial controls; tracking schedule progress; and owning critical closeout workstreams including GC pay applications, landlord TI reimbursement packages, lien waivers, and punch list completion. This role is a launch pad for a Project Manager track at VASA. The PE/APM gains direct exposure to executive stakeholders, program-level initiatives (cost reduction, schedule compression, design standardization), and the full lifecycle of national TI delivery.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ain project records, drawings, RFIs, submittals, change orders, and meeting minutes in Procore as the single source of truth across all assigned projects.
  • Lead weekly Owner / Architect / Contractor (OAC) calls set agendas, capture minutes, distribute action items, and follow through to closure.
  • Coordinate distribution and version control of construction documents, ASIs, and bulletins between architects, GCs, and internal stakeholders.
  • Assist with interpretation of drawings and specifications; route RFIs and design questions between the field and the design team for timely resolution.
  • Track GC pay applications against approved schedules of values; verify lien waiver compliance (conditional and unconditional, primary and lower-tier) before processing.
  • Prepare monthly landlord TI reimbursement draw packages assemble invoices, lien waivers, inspection reports, and required certifications per each lease's TI provisions; coordinate with Accounting and Legal on submission and follow-through to receipt of funds.
  • Maintain the project cost log and forecast tool; flag budget variances and contingency draws to the PM in real time.
  • Process change order requests (CORs): validate scope and pricing, route for internal approval, and execute through Procore.
  • Support lump-sum contract administration, including reconciliation of GC General Conditions, allowances, and savings.
  • Assist in development and weekly maintenance of the master project schedule; track milestone variances and critical-path risks.
  • Manage owner-furnished equipment (OFE) procurement and delivery fitness equipment, AV, signage, FF&E coordinating lead times against the construction schedule.
  • Coordinate field-initiated purchasing and expedite long-lead items to prevent schedule slippage.
  • Participate in jobsite walks, pre-installation meetings, and quality control inspections; document deficiencies and confirm resolution.
  • Support permit applications and Authority Having Jurisdiction (AHJ) coordination using VASA's permitting platform (Pulley) and direct GC engagement.
  • Track permit milestones and inspection sign-offs (rough-in, mid-construction, final, health, fire) through CO issuance.
  • Help drive program-level permitting time reductions through documentation standardization and submission quality control.
  • Drive punch list compilation and closure across architectural, MEP, and equipment scopes.
  • Assemble closeout documentation: as-builts, O&M manuals, warranties, training records, attic stock, and final lien releases.
  • Coordinate operational turnover to the Operations team equipment commissioning, life-safety verification, and day-one readiness.
  • Support post-CO landlord TI reimbursement to full collection; reduce backlog of outstanding TI dollars through milestone-linked submission discipline.
